Transaction 3d654cc13126f9967061cc77d601811b85dd8422a6fb592006fd8206d2a912df

1 Input
2 Outputs
  • 3d654cc13126f9967061cc77d601811b85dd8422a6fb592006fd8206d2a912df:0
  • value  45778
    address  1ARK2eGYCZKBKHSERMHvkRqBxxNVm21uHf
  • 3d654cc13126f9967061cc77d601811b85dd8422a6fb592006fd8206d2a912df:1
  • value  27283123
    address  1HUqCPnsZg7XMHhsbzY4Sw8kt74BTt5bta